Listings, answered.
Where does Ninja update my details?
Google first, then Apple Maps, Bing, Facebook, Yelp, Instagram and TripAdvisor — the places customers actually check. Smaller directories get the same update in the background.
What exactly gets kept in sync?
Your business name, address, phone, hours and category. Change any of them once in Ninja and the update goes out for you.
Can you remove a duplicate listing?
Ninja finds duplicates and submits removal or correction requests. Each directory decides on its own timeline, so some clear in days and a few take longer — you can see the status the whole way.
What if a directory changes my info on its own?
It happens more than owners realise, usually from an old data feed. Ninja watches for it, puts the correct details back, and tells you what changed.
Is this the main reason to use Ninja?
No. Your Google profile is what gets you found and called — that is the core of every plan. Listings are included because consistent details help Google trust the profile it is ranking.
